全省消防安全治本攻坚成效显著
Xin Lang Cai Jing· 2026-02-12 19:35
Core Viewpoint - The provincial fire rescue team aims to enhance fire safety governance by implementing a three-year action plan focused on key areas such as electric bicycles, building insulation materials, hot work operations, and ensuring clear "life passageways" [1][2] Group 1: Fire Safety Governance - The provincial government has established a regular fire safety discussion mechanism, integrating fire safety work into the overall safety construction assessment system, achieving comprehensive oversight and evaluation [1] - The government has introduced the first national regulations in the fire safety sector for energy storage stations, creating a collaborative regulatory framework with multiple departments [1] Group 2: Fire Safety Achievements - In 2025, the province reported no major fire incidents, with building fire indicators below the national average, and significant progress in key tasks [1] - A total of 43,000 units were inspected, with 48,000 fire hazards rectified, and 60 major fire hazards were placed under special supervision [2] - Fire incidents in key areas such as electric bicycles, hot work operations, and insulation materials decreased by 78.3%, 57.7%, and 100% respectively, while issues related to blocked "life passageways" dropped by 83.2% [2] Group 3: Investment in Fire Safety Infrastructure - Over 400 million yuan was invested to complete fire safety upgrades in old communities and schools, establishing 3,000 standardized charging ports for electric bicycles [2] - The "smart fire safety" initiative progressed, with 18,000 independent fire alarm detectors installed in small venues, enhancing the precision of grassroots fire governance [2] Group 4: Public Awareness and Training - Various forms of fire safety training and publicity were conducted, with 892 sessions held, training 56,200 individuals to improve public awareness and self-rescue capabilities [2]

从“无人问”到“有人管”
Xin Lang Cai Jing· 2026-01-07 23:22
Core Viewpoint - The article discusses a comprehensive fire safety inspection initiative in the Douyuan Apartment, a high-rise residential building without property management, aimed at addressing fire safety issues through a collaborative governance model involving the residents' committee, community, and professional support [1][2][3] Group 1: Fire Safety Inspection and Findings - A thorough fire safety inspection was conducted in Douyuan Apartment, identifying 12 core fire hazards including issues with fire pumps, alarm systems, blocked evacuation routes, and ineffective fire doors [1] - The inspection team created a detailed "hazard list" for each building, allowing for precise tracking of risk points and remediation progress [1] Group 2: Remediation Efforts - The inspection team addressed 51 issues related to blocked fire lanes and damaged fire facilities, ensuring that each identified problem was rectified promptly [2] - Educational initiatives were implemented, including the distribution of informative posters and training sessions for residents to enhance their awareness of fire safety and self-rescue capabilities [2] Group 3: Long-term Management Mechanism - A long-term management mechanism was established, assigning the residents' committee the primary responsibility for supervising fire facility maintenance, with funding prioritized from public revenue [2] - The community's daily inspection and reporting responsibilities were reinforced, alongside regular guidance and training from the street's emergency fire station, creating a collaborative governance structure [2] Group 4: Technological Advancements - The initiative includes plans to enhance "smart fire safety" measures, such as installing electric vehicle lift prohibition systems and remote monitoring devices for fire water pressure, transitioning from traditional management to a more integrated approach [2] - The goal is to achieve early risk warnings, rapid hazard resolution, and sustainable management practices [2] Group 5: Future Expansion - The successful model of governance is intended to be replicated in other high-rise residential buildings without property management in the district, contributing to a more robust urban fire safety network [3]

青鸟消防:公司已自主研发HRP高可靠性专用无线消防物联网系统
Core Viewpoint - Qingniao Fire has developed an autonomous high-reliability wireless fire IoT system, HRP, which is suitable for deployment in challenging environments like temporary buildings and old communities [1] Group 1: Product Features - The HRP system features high reliability, high safety, high real-time performance, low power consumption, and long communication distance [1] - The system includes various devices such as wireless gateways, smoke detectors, temperature sensors, and sound-light alarms, enabling early fire warning and rapid response [1] Group 2: Deployment and Cost Efficiency - The smart fire and wireless system does not require wiring, making installation convenient and allowing for repeat deployment by construction units, which only incur initial purchase costs [1] - This solution balances safety and economic efficiency, avoiding additional business burdens for users [1] Group 3: Monitoring and Alerts - The system can upload real-time monitoring data to the Qingniao Fire cloud platform, facilitating remote monitoring and notification [1] - Management personnel can monitor building fire safety status at any time, with the system sending timely alerts to mobile apps when anomalies are detected [1]
秦皇岛经开区智慧消防有前景
Jing Ji Ri Bao· 2025-11-30 22:39
Core Insights - The article highlights the advancements in the smart fire detection industry, particularly focusing on the operations of Qinhuangdao Taihe An Technology Co., Ltd, which utilizes automated production lines to enhance efficiency and reduce costs [1][2]. Group 1: Company Operations - Qinhuangdao Taihe An Technology Co., Ltd has implemented a production line that integrates 24 processes, allowing for the production of 2,000 smart smoke detectors per hour [1]. - The company employs a patented dual-light maze technology that reduces false alarm rates by 90% compared to traditional detectors [1]. Group 2: Industry Collaboration - The Qinhuangdao Economic and Technological Development Zone hosts nearly 20 companies in the fire electronic products sector, creating a complete industrial chain from design to manufacturing [1]. - Collaboration between companies, such as Taihe An and Hengye Century Safety Technology Co., Ltd, has led to cost savings and improved production efficiency through shared resources and supply chain integration [2]. Group 3: Innovation and Development - The region emphasizes innovation-driven development by integrating resources from universities and research institutions, forming technology teams to address industry challenges [3]. - The average R&D investment intensity among companies in the smart fire industry cluster is 6.8%, indicating a strong commitment to innovation [3]. - The "Smart Fire Cloud Platform" developed in the region has connected over 100,000 terminal devices, showcasing the integration of advanced technologies like big data and cloud computing into the industry [3].
